China's state-owned contractor company China Harber Engineering Company Limited has been blacklisted (Black Listed).
The institution offered a bribe of Tk 50 lakh to a secretary. When the secretary informed the government about this, China's Harbar was blacklisted.
Finance Minister Abul Maal Abdul Muhith told reporters after meeting with the World Bank Vice President Ennet Dixon on Tuesday afternoon.
The Finance Minister said, according to the rules, no black listed company can work in any country.
In response to a question, the minister said, why should I punish the secretary? He has informed the government about the matter.
China's contractor has been appointed as a contractor for several projects in Bangladesh. What are those projects? Responding to a question whether the contractor tried to give a bribe in terms of work, Muhith said that only the blacklisted. Now the government will decide how those projects will be implemented. And yes, not to get a specific job, the secretary was probably tried to be happy. But the secretary did not accept their illegal offer. Rather, he informed the government on time. He showed a good example.
